The Rise of Cloud Gaming
Cloud gaming has emerged as a transformative force in the gaming industry, allowing players to access high-quality games without the need for powerful hardware. This technology enables games to be streamed directly from servers to a variety of devices, including smartphones, tablets, and smart TVs. As internet speeds improve globally, the accessibility of cloud gaming is set to expand, reaching a broader audience and democratizing the gaming experience. Major players like Google, Microsoft, and NVIDIA are heavily investing in cloud gaming platforms, which allows them to leverage their existing infrastructures. By offering subscription models, these companies create opportunities for players to experience a vast library of games without upfront costs. This trend also caters to casual gamers who may not invest in expensive gaming consoles or PCs, thereby expanding the market.
The environmental impact of gaming hardware is also mitigated by cloud gaming, as fewer physical devices are needed. This shift towards streaming aligns with growing consumer awareness about sustainability, making cloud gaming not only a technological advancement but also an environmentally friendly solution. This evolution is likely to redefine how games are developed, marketed, and consumed in the coming years.
Virtual Reality and Augmented Reality Integration
Vir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) are set to reshape the gaming landscape by creating immersive experiences that transport players into fantastical worlds. VR technology allows gamers to engage in environments that feel incredibly real, enhancing emotional connections and gameplay. Titles like “Beat Saber” and “Half-Life: Alyx” have demonstrated the potential of VR, drawing in both hardcore and casual gamers.
On the other hand, AR games like “Pokémon GO” have shown how this technology can blend the real world with digital elements. The success of such games suggests a significant market for AR experiences, which can transform everyday environments into interactive playgrounds. As hardware becomes more affordable and widespread, we can expect to see an influx of AR titles that challenge traditional gaming formats.
The future of gaming is undoubtedly intertwined with these technologies. Developers are constantly experimenting with how VR and AR can enhance storytelling, gameplay mechanics, and social interactions. As a result, the gaming community will likely witness a surge in innovative designs and creative gameplay that fully utilize these immersive technologies, further pushing the boundaries of what gaming can be.
The Growth of Esports
Esports has rapidly evolved from a niche market into a global phenomenon, attracting millions of viewers and significant investments. Tournaments like “The International” and “League of Legends World Championship” are not only drawing large crowds but also offering substantial prize pools, making competitive gaming a viable career for many players. This growth is fueled by increased accessibility to gaming and the rise of streaming platforms.
With the expansion of esports, educational institutions are starting to offer scholarships for aspiring players, further legitimizing gaming as a competitive field. High schools and colleges are establishing esports teams, creating a pipeline for talent development that mirrors traditional sports. This integration into academic institutions marks a significant cultural shift, showcasing the acceptance and normalization of gaming in society.
Sponsorship deals and advertising in the esports space are also on the rise, with brands recognizing the value of engaging with the younger demographic that makes up a majority of the gaming audience. As esports continues to grow, we can expect a further blend of traditional sports elements with gaming, creating a new kind of entertainment that appeals to both gamers and sports fans alike.
Blockchain Technology and Game Ownership
Blockchain technology is emerging as a groundbreaking aspect of the gaming industry, offering players true ownership of in-game assets through non-fungible tokens (NFTs). This innovation allows gamers to buy, sell, and trade unique digital items, creating a secondary market that can enhance the gaming experience. Players can invest in their favorite games and maintain ownership of their assets, which has the potential to change how games are monetized.
Furthermore, blockchain technology introduces transparency and security to transactions, reducing fraud and enhancing trust among gamers. As more developers explore integrating blockchain into their games, we can anticipate a wave of titles that offer players tangible returns on their investments. This trend not only rewards players for their time and effort but also encourages creativity and engagement within gaming communities.
However, the implementation of blockchain in gaming is still in its infancy, and various challenges need to be addressed, such as environmental concerns related to energy consumption. Despite these hurdles, the potential for innovative gaming experiences backed by blockchain technology is immense. As this trend develops, it could redefine ownership and community dynamics in the gaming industry.
